The new art for the High Rock 30th anniversary has arrived, by the hand of
the inimitable Tex Forrest:

http://highrockflyin.chgpa.org/HighRock-shirt-art.gif

We haven't settled on the prices yet (waiting for a quote) but will have
both short and long sleeved versions available.

As far as the cost for the fly-in, it's looking something like this:

food: $10 (we do MUCH more than burgers and dogs - and plan to do roast
meats for the omnivours with roasted portabello mushrooms for the veggies,
so everyone gets their money's worth).
beer: $5 - we only buy the good stuff, like sam adams.
Saturday Flying fee/weekend camping fee: $10 - This ensures the carbaughs
get their cut regardless of the weather. This time we will bring the log
book to dinner so people will remember to log saturday flights.

Add that up, that's $25 for the full ticket. We will offer ala-carte
registration for those who don't drink beer, don't fly or camp, etc, but
to reduce the programming burden on poor Ralph only the full registration
will be offered electronically.
For those who think this is alot, remember
1. the donation per flying day has increased since last year
2. It's a fundraiser to keep the site going, not a fast food resturant.
We really only offer the food, beer, tshirts, raffles etc. to help you get in
the mood to part with your money for a good cause.

There will be some amazing CD retrospectives on sale done by Sparky, and a
raffle with items you won't see at other fly-ins.
